Forum d'entraide à la création de jeux d'aventure
 
PortailPortail  AccueilAccueil  RechercherRechercher  S'enregistrerS'enregistrer  Connexion  
-14%
Le deal à ne pas rater :
Lave-linge hublot HOOVER HWP 10 kg (Induction, 1600 trs/min, Classe ...
299.99 € 349.99 €
Voir le deal

 

 [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"

Aller en bas 
3 participants
AuteurMessage
Barmund
C'est quoi la Tasse Bleue ?
C'est quoi la Tasse Bleue ?
Barmund


Nombre de messages : 26

Date d'inscription : 24/07/2016


[rés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" Empty
MessageSujet: [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"   [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" EmptyDim 24 Juil 2016 - 12:09

Bonjour,

Alors voilà, j'étais sur AGS et mon pc portable s'est éteint (plus de batterie), je venais de sauvegarder avec l'icone "Save Game" à gauche de "Build Game" mais pas la sauvegarde proposé en fermant le logiciel.
J'ai rallumé mon pc et là, impossible d'ouvrir mon fichier !
Un premier message s'affiche :


"Unable to read the user preference file. You may lose some of your Preference settings and may not be able to access Source Control.
The error was: Elément racine manquant"


Je clique sur Ok, puis un second message :


"An erro occurred whilst trying to load your game. The error was:
Elément racine manquant.
If you cannot resolve the error, please post on the AAGS Technical Forum for assistance.

Error details: System.Xml.XmlException: Elément racine manquant.
   à System.Xml.XmlTextReaderImpl.Throw(Exception e)
   à System.Xml.XmlTextReaderImpl.ThrowWithoutLineInfo(String res)
   à System.Xml.XmlTextReaderImpl.ParseDocumentContent()
   à System.Xml.XmlTextReaderImpl.Read()
   à System.Xml.XmlLoader.Load(XmlDocument doc, XmlReader reader,
Boolean preserveWhitespace)
   à System.Xml.XmlDocument.Load(XmlReader reader)
   à System.Xml.XmlDocument.Load(String filename)
   à AGS.Editor.AGSEditor.LoadGameFile(String fileName)
   à AGS.Editor.Tasks.LoadGameFromDisk(String gameToLoad, Boolean
interactive.)
   à AGS.Editor.InteractiveTasks.LoadGameFromDisk(String
gameToLoad)"



puis je clique sur Ok et ça me remet à l'écran de choix de fichier, en choisissant de nouveau le fichier voulu j'ai de nouveau ces deux messages.

J'avais un second fichier qui, lui, fonctionne correctement, mais ce n'est pas celui là que je souhaite charger, donc...

Après plusieurs recherches sur internet sans résultat, je me suis dit qu'il devait y avoir un sujet sur le forum anglais, j'ai donc tapé "AGS root element missing" et suis tombé sur cette page. Enfin quelqu'un à qui cela est arrivé et qui a su résoudre ce problème !

Voilà le lien :
http://www.adventuregamestudio.co.uk/forums/index.php?topic=39770.0

Et le post de NeonGames, celui qui a résolu ce problème :

"I´m SOOOOOOOOOOOOOOO HAPPY!!!! ;D
I´ve resolved this damned error sourire´
In my backup copy I deleted the "Game.agf.user", deleted "Game.agf"(with blue cup icon) and renamed my "Game.agf.bak" to "Game.agf" and that it works!!!"


J'ai donc fait cette manipulation : effacer "Game.agf.user" et "Game.agf" (il y avait écrit que Game avec l'icone de la tasse bleue, mais dans les propriété il y avait bien l'extension .agf) puis j'ai renommé le fichier "Game.agf.bak" par "Game.agf"
mais contrairement à NeonGames, pour moi ça n'a pas fonctionné....

A présent je n'ai plus le premier message d'erreur, mais toujours le second, en cliquant sur Ok, de retour au choix de fichier...


Si quelqu'un a une idée pour résoudre ce problème, ou au moins recommencer un nouveau fichier mais en récupérant tout ce que j'ai fait dans ce fichier corrompu, mes Gui, mes Sprites, mes Scripts et mes Characters...

Et au passage, si je copie un fichier (non corrompu) sur une clé usb, et qu'il arrive quelque chose comme ça, est ce qu'en remettant le fichier sur mon pc je pourrait relancer mon fichier sans problème ?

Et une dernière question, j'ai fait régulièrement des "Build Game", à ce que j'ai compris cela compile le fichier pour le restaurer en cas de problème, non ? Parce que si c'est ça, je devrais récupérer facilement mes données, non ?

Autre information : je n'ai pas changé mes fichiers de places, tout fonctionnait parfaitement jusqu'à l'arrêt de l'ordinateur. Je ne suis pas sur mais il est possible que la coupure est eu lieu pile au moment où j'ai cliqué sur "Run" pour tester le jeu, donc peut-être que ça a coupé pile au moment des petites sauvegardes ou chargements qu'il y a avant d'ouvrir la fenêtre Run...

J’espère réellement que quelqu'un saura résoudre mon problème, car je n'aimerais pas tout recommencer depuis le début...

Merci d'avance. (Et désolé du pavé ^^ )


Dernière édition par Barmund le Dim 24 Juil 2016 - 16:59, édité 2 fois
Revenir en haut Aller en bas
Thebroch
Cliqueur Emérite
Cliqueur Emérite
Thebroch


Nombre de messages : 603

Age : 24

Localisation : Lorient

Date d'inscription : 23/07/2015


[rés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" Empty
MessageSujet: Re: [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"   [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" EmptyDim 24 Juil 2016 - 13:24

Je suis désolé mais il y a de fort risque que le fichiers sois corrompue dance ce cas tu peux éventuellement restaurer le fichier a une date ultérieur.

Pour le message d'erreur j'ai pas tout compris alors je laisse la parole a ceux qui savent mieux que moi clin d'oeil !

Bonne journée

_________________
Le café au bois ça consiste à moudre une cafetière et à la mettre dans des copeaux de bois.
Revenir en haut Aller en bas
Kitai
Délégué de la tasse bleue
Délégué de la tasse bleue
Kitai


Nombre de messages : 2907

Date d'inscription : 01/08/2006


[rés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" Empty
MessageSujet: Re: [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"   [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" EmptyDim 24 Juil 2016 - 13:57

Salut Barmund,

Avant tout, juste par précaution, je tiens à préciser qu'il faut toujours garder des copies de tous les fichiers qu'on manipule jusqu'à résolution du problème, donc même quand on "supprime" un fichier il faut en fait en garder une copie déplacée/renommée tant que le problème n'est pas résolu.

Barmund a écrit:
J'ai donc fait cette manipulation : effacer "Game.agf.user" et "Game.agf" (il y avait écrit que Game avec l'icone de la tasse bleue, mais dans les propriété il y avait bien l'extension .agf) puis j'ai renommé le fichier "Game.agf.bak" par "Game.agf"
mais contrairement à NeonGames, pour moi ça n'a pas fonctionné....
Tu dis que tu ne voyais pas directement l'extension de Game.afg, du coup je me dis que renommer Game.agf.bak en Game.agf n'a pas forcément fonctionné comme prévu. Est-ce que ".agf" a disparu après que tu as renommé le fichier, et est-ce que l'extension apparaît dans les propriétés comme avant ?

Aussi, est-ce que tu as gardé une copie du premier fichier Game.agf avant que tu le supprimes ? Tu peux essayer de le restaurer (conserve aussi Game.agf.bak) : peut-être que le problème venait uniquement du fichier Game.agf.user, donc ça vaudrait le coup d'essayer en supprimant uniquement ce fichier.

Par ailleurs, si tu as des copies backup de tes fichiers (par exemple si tu utilises Dropbox), tu peux essayer d'utiliser ces copies-là pour remplacer ton fichier Game.agf.

Barmund a écrit:
Et au passage, si je copie un fichier (non corrompu) sur une clé usb, et qu'il arrive quelque chose comme ça, est ce qu'en remettant le fichier sur mon pc je pourrait relancer mon fichier sans problème ?
Théoriquement, oui, tu devrais pouvoir relancer ton projet à l'état où il en était au moment de la copie.

Barmund a écrit:
Et une dernière question, j'ai fait régulièrement des "Build Game", à ce que j'ai compris cela compile le fichier pour le restaurer en cas de problème, non ? Parce que si c'est ça, je devrais récupérer facilement mes données, non ?
L'option "Build Game" sert à compiler les fichiers qui seront proposés au joueur au final. Je ne sais pas dans quelle mesure ça génère aussi un autre fichier que tu peux utiliser pour restaurer le projet.

_________________
Ga is Ga
Vous pouvez consulter l'aide d'AGS 3.2 en français et contribuer à la traduction et à l'amélioration si le cœur vous en dit !
Revenir en haut Aller en bas
http://admin.no.uchi.free.fr/dokuwiki-2008-05-05/doku.php
Barmund
C'est quoi la Tasse Bleue ?
C'est quoi la Tasse Bleue ?
Barmund


Nombre de messages : 26

Date d'inscription : 24/07/2016


[rés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" Empty
MessageSujet: Re: [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"   [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" EmptyDim 24 Juil 2016 - 14:25

Bonjour, et merci de vos réponses.


-Alors, comme vous me l'avez conseillé, j'ai restauré mon fichier Game et ça a marché ! Plus de message d'erreur, mais du coup il y a certaines choses perdues, mais au moins je peux reprendre un fichier pas trop ancien ! Merci !
Mais bon, je vais quand même essayer de récupérer l'ensemble de mes données...




-Kitai a écrit :
Tu dis que tu ne voyais pas directement l'extension de Game.afg, du coup je me dis que renommer Game.agf.bak en Game.agf n'a pas forcément fonctionné comme prévu. Est-ce que ".agf" a disparu après que tu as renommé le fichier, et est-ce que l'extension apparaît dans les propriétés comme avant ?

->J'ai d'abord dû supprimer Game.agf (juste Game) pour pouvoir renommer Game.agf.bak en Game.agf (car sinon il y aurait eu deux "Game.agf").
Et oui, là actuellement, même après l'avoir restauré, le fichier Game.agf ne s'affiche que Game avec l'icone de la tasse, et dans les propriété du fichier il y a écrit :
Type du fichier : AGS Game (.agf)
C'est pas comme ça pour tout le monde ?



- Kitai a écrit :
Aussi, est-ce que tu as gardé une copie du premier fichier Game.agf avant que tu le supprimes ? Tu peux essayer de le restaurer (conserve aussi Game.agf.bak) :

->Oui, et je l'ai restaurée, mais j'ai toujours la copie avant restauration, donc s'il y a moyen de résoudre le problème en gardant toutes mes données depuis la restauration j'ai toujours le fichier corrompu.



-Kitai a écrit :
peut-être que le problème venait uniquement du fichier Game.agf.user, donc ça vaudrait le coup d'essayer en supprimant uniquement ce fichier.

->Non je pense qu'il venait uniquement du fichier Game.agf car là j'ai tout remis (le "Game.agf.bak" et le "Game.agf.user") et ça remarche, donc apparemment ça vient bien du fichier Game.agf.




-Kitai a écrit :
Par ailleurs, si tu as des copies backup de tes fichiers (par exemple si tu utilises Dropbox), tu peux essayer d'utiliser ces copies-là pour remplacer ton fichier Game.agf.

->J'ai un fichier "backup_acsprset.spr", est ce que c'est celui-là ?
Si oui, comment je fais pour remplacer le fichier Game.agf par le backup ? Et qu'est ce que ça va faire exactement ? Reprendre une sauvegarde plus ancienne ?
Revenir en haut Aller en bas
Kitai
Délégué de la tasse bleue
Délégué de la tasse bleue
Kitai


Nombre de messages : 2907

Date d'inscription : 01/08/2006


[rés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" Empty
MessageSujet: Re: [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"   [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" EmptyDim 24 Juil 2016 - 15:39

Tu peux utiliser les balises
[quote="Kitai" ][/quote ] (sans l'espace avant les crochets fermants) pour citer un (extrait de) message. C'est ce que je fais personnellement.


Barmund a écrit:
->J'ai d'abord dû supprimer Game.agf (juste Game) pour pouvoir renommer Game.agf.bak en Game.agf (car sinon il y aurait eu deux "Game.agf").
Ça veut donc dire que le renommage fonctionne comme prévu.

Barmund a écrit:
Et oui, là actuellement, même après l'avoir restauré, le fichier Game.agf ne s'affiche que Game avec l'icone de la tasse, et dans les propriété du fichier il y a écrit :
Type du fichier : AGS Game (.agf)
C'est pas comme ça pour tout le monde ?
Tu peux régler les propriétés de ton navigateur pour toujours afficher l'extension des fichiers, même lorsque le type de fichier est connu.

Barmund a écrit:
Oui, et je l'ai restaurée, mais j'ai toujours la copie avant restauration, donc s'il y a moyen de résoudre le problème en gardant toutes mes données depuis la restauration j'ai toujours le fichier corrompu.
Vu que le projet ne se lance pas lorsque tu utilises le fichier .bak, j'ai un peu peur que ce soit fichu pour la version la plus récente...


Barmund a écrit:
->J'ai un fichier "backup_acsprset.spr", est ce que c'est celui-là ?
Si oui, comment je fais pour remplacer le fichier Game.agf par le backup ? Et qu'est ce que ça va faire exactement ? Reprendre une sauvegarde plus ancienne ?
Le fichier (backup_)acsprset.spr contient, il me semble, les ressources graphiques de ton projet. Donc pas question de le renommer Game.agf.
Quand je parlais de copies backup, je parlais d'un système qui crée régulièrement des copies des fichiers dans certains de tes dossiers soit vers un serveur externe/en ligne (c'est le cas de Dropbox) soit vers un disque externe ou non (disque dur/clé USB, etc. c'est le cas avec des logiciels de type Backup & Recovery).[/quote]

_________________
Ga is Ga
Vous pouvez consulter l'aide d'AGS 3.2 en français et contribuer à la traduction et à l'amélioration si le cœur vous en dit !
Revenir en haut Aller en bas
http://admin.no.uchi.free.fr/dokuwiki-2008-05-05/doku.php
Barmund
C'est quoi la Tasse Bleue ?
C'est quoi la Tasse Bleue ?
Barmund


Nombre de messages : 26

Date d'inscription : 24/07/2016


[rés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" Empty
MessageSujet: Re: [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"   [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" EmptyDim 24 Juil 2016 - 16:03

Kitai a écrit:
Quand je parlais de copies backup, je parlais d'un système qui crée régulièrement des copies des fichiers dans certains de tes dossiers soit vers un serveur externe/en ligne

Ah non, j'ai pas ça.

Kitai a écrit:
Vu que le projet ne se lance pas lorsque tu utilises le fichier .bak, j'ai un peu peur que ce soit fichu pour la version la plus récente...

Bah tant pis, de toute façon il n'y avait pas tant à refaire depuis la restauration.

En tout cas merci beaucoup !!! sourire

Revenir en haut Aller en bas
Contenu sponsorisé





[rés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" Empty
MessageSujet: Re: [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"   [rés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ant" Empty

Revenir en haut Aller en bas
 
[résolu] Impossible d'ouvrir mon fichier, error : "Elément racine manquant"
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» [résolu]Unhandled error causée par les dialogues
» [résolu] Error (line 44): Undefined token 'oPomme'
» [résolu]fichier .cha ou tga
» [résolu]Lire/Sauver des données dans un fichier externe
» [résolu]Comment importer un dessin papier/une photo dans AGS?resolu

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Adventure Games Studio fr :: CREATION DE JEUX :: Questions / Réponses-
Sauter vers: